The Role
You will play a key role in delivering accurate, timely, and insightful group financial reporting, supporting senior decision-making and ensuring a robust control environment across the organisation.
Key Responsibilities
- Prepare and deliver high-quality group financial reporting, including detailed analysis and insights for senior management.
- Support the consolidation of multi-currency group management accounts and oversee the monthly reporting cycle.
- Assist in the preparation of consolidated financial statements in line with applicable accounting standards.
- Manage elements of the month-end and year-end close processes, ensuring accuracy and adherence to deadlines.
- Act as a key contact for external auditors, coordinating deliverables and resolving queries.
- Prepare and review consolidation adjustments and ensure consistent accounting treatment across the Group.
- Support the development and implementation of group accounting policies and best practices.
- Deliver budgeting and cost analysis to support planning and performance tracking.
- Assist with regulatory reporting requirements.
- Support acquisition accounting and integration of new businesses into group reporting.
- Identify and implement process improvements, including automation and system enhancements.
- Partner with stakeholders across the business on finance-related projects.
About You
- Qualified ACA / ACCA with approximately 5 - 7 years post qualified experience and excellent academic record.
- Strong experience in group reporting and consolidations within a multi-entity environment.
- Solid technical accounting knowledge.
- Confident communicator with the ability to engage a wide range of stakeholders.
